ALTEK receives funding to support commercialisation of ALUSALT technology

ALTEK, a technology based company with expertise and experience in aluminium dross and scrap processing systems, signed funding agreement with Santander Corporate & Commercial.

Alan Peel, Managing Director of ALTEK Europe, said: “We’ve been leading the way with new technologies for the aluminium manufacturing sector for decades and are excited that we can now start to commercialise our latest innovation, the ALUSALT technology.”

Santander Corporate & Commercial will invest £2.65m to help the commercialisation of ALUSALT technology across Europe.  Full commercialisation of the technology will start next year.

“With increased focus on CO2 minimisation and the development of closed loop recycling technologies to eliminate waste and landfill, we are hopeful that this process will not only have a beneficial environmental impact globally but will also save our customers significant operating costs.”
